Output d95d4e18c2c3c3fb142a902a8fcda7b7a78ff6bbc944427dbcacb1e7b132ec95:1

value
1552415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 164bee14fc80c376145559bc04c87ea91e7c39b8 OP_EQUAL
address
33iukUQwHfLRnjCBxQvPzvvBuFuz47ondm
transaction
d95d4e18c2c3c3fb142a902a8fcda7b7a78ff6bbc944427dbcacb1e7b132ec95